Goldfish vs. Koi
When it comes to goldfish vs. koi there are real differences. For instance.
A koi pond needs to be bigger then a goldfish pond. Probably much bigger. Deeper too. That's because koi will continue to grow despite the size of their living quarters. Which I would say pretty much rules out one of those space saving koi patio ponds if our friend Bill has koi on the brain.
|
Then too you'll find koi are more relaxed stately swimmers than goldfish. Which tend to dart around a bit more.
Colorwise you can get koi and goldfish in a variety of colors. But I'd say that koi come out ahead when it comes to color. As they've been bred to be viewed from up above. Goldfish haven't. So chalk one up for koi in the great goldfish vs. koi debate. <smile>
Finally koi are affectionately referred to as "pond pigs". That is they bring a big appetite to the table. So it may well cost you more in chow to keep koi than goldfish. And require more pond maintenance since what goes in must come out?
Either way goldfish and koi are the most popular types of pond fish available. Due in large part to the fact both are colorful and offer the greatest visibility in pond water. So goldfish vs koi? The final decision is up to you and your backyard pond situation.
